Originally Posted By DlandDug DlandJB has been away from the boards for a while. Many of you will recall that in May of 2011 she was in cardiac arrest, and shortly after was given a pacemaker/defibrillator. That fall she was made a candidate for a heart transplant at UCLA. Early last year she had an emergency operation after experiencing peritonitis and diverticulitis of the lower colon. This was followed by nearly a year off the list for a heart transplant as she waited for all infection to clear up. This winter Jamie was finally put back on the list for a heart transplant. And on last Wednesday, she got her new heart! She is still recuperating at the hospital, with a lengthy convalescence ahead. But 2013 will be the start of a whole new lease on life.
